Nutmeg is the culinary spice obtained from the seed of Myristica fragrans, the same tree whose seed covering yields mace. Culinary quantities are inert, but very large ingestions of the ground seed can cause a slow-onset, long-lasting intoxication attributed chiefly to the aromatic constituents myristicin, elemicin, and safrole, often accompanied by anticholinergic-like features such as tachycardia and agitation. Myristicin is additionally reported to possess weak monoamine oxidase inhibitory activity, and its structural resemblance to amphetamine precursors has prompted speculation about amphetamine- or MDMA-like metabolites, though such conversion in humans remains unproven. Case series and poisoning reports characterize the experience as unpredictable and generally unpleasant; documented exposures have required medical evaluation but have not typically been life-threatening, and toxicokinetic analysis of the psychoactive constituents in serum has been performed in overdose cases.

Mechanism
Nutmeg's psychoactivity comes mainly from two volatile phenylpropene oils, myristicin and elemicin. Their exact central mechanism is not fully pinned down, but the intoxication has a strongly anticholinergic (deliriant) character; dry mouth, flushing, confusion, and a foggy, dreamlike delirium, which is why it is grouped with the deliriants rather than the classic psychedelics. Myristicin is also a weak, reversible inhibitor of monoamine oxidase (the enzyme that breaks down , , and noradrenaline), so at high intake it behaves as a mild . A popular and much-repeated idea is that the body converts myristicin and elemicin into amphetamine- or MDMA-like (MMDA) or even cannabinoid-like metabolites; this remains speculative and is not well established in humans.

Safetyrisks and cautions, not medical advice
In normal culinary amounts nutmeg is safe; the danger is entirely dose-dependent. High doses cause a rough, prolonged toxicity; nausea and vomiting, a racing heart, dizziness, dry mouth, agitation, and an anticholinergic-flavored delirium that is usually frightening rather than fun, followed by a hangover that can drag on for a day or more. Because myristicin acts as a mild MAO inhibitor, large amounts carry the classic MAOI cautions; combining it with tyramine-rich aged or fermented foods (aged cheese, cured meats, some wines) can in theory raise blood pressure, and stacking it with serotonergic drugs (SSRIs and other antidepressants, certain migraine or pain medicines, MDMA) risks serotonin syndrome, a dangerous overload of serotonin. FAQ
Is nutmeg in food dangerous?
No. The amounts used in cooking and baking are far below anything psychoactive; the risk only appears at the very large doses people take deliberately to get high.
Does nutmeg really get you high?
At high doses, yes, but it is a slow, long, and by most accounts miserable deliriant intoxication with heavy nausea and a lingering hangover, not a pleasant recreational experience.
Is nutmeg an MAOI?
Weakly. Its component myristicin mildly inhibits monoamine oxidase, so at high intake the standard MAOI cautions apply; watch tyramine-rich foods and avoid combining it with serotonergic drugs.
